Default Turn key, and nothing happens

This has happened a few times before and it seems like waiting a few min and it goes back to normal. Prob year and half ago it did it and had it towed in but can't remember what dealer said it was. It doesn't try to start or nothing. Turn key and the normal ticking under hood but trun to crank, and it stays silent. Any clues?
